"And,'’ he continued when they both needed to breathe once again, “we shall not wait. I have waited quite long enough."

"We must. The banns, the gowns, the wedding breakfast,” she said, twinkling up at him. “So much to do."

"I wrote to Doctor's Commons for a special license soon after I met you. I am well prepared. As for the rest, I wouldn't worry about gowns,” and he gave her a look that sent tremors down to her toes, “and anyone who is so rash as to appear at
our
front door can jolly well feed himself. At least for some time to come."

"Just so you keep me in bonnets, my dear."

"As long as that's all you desire."

Her giggle was lost in his embrace, and neither one heard the calls from the house.

It seemed that Miss Fairchild no longer need fear being left on the shelf.
